**Runbook: Cron Migration — Account Recovery**

We are moving legacy cron jobs from the Hollowfen boxes to the Skeinworks workflow engine. Each migrated job runs under the shared `wf-runner` account. If that account is locked mid-migration, jobs on both systems stall — check the Skeinworks dashboard for dual failures before acting. Do not re-enable cron on Hollowfen; it causes duplicate runs. Instead, restore `wf-runner` through the recovery prompt, which accepts the passphrase below.

vault phrase of bagaf-kajeg = jorath-feniel-briir-siliel-ralix

Present: Ms. Okafor-Vane (chair), Mr. Tillery, Ms. Brandt.

The board reviewed the revised sales-commission scheme for the Meridor division. Key changes: tiered rates replacing flat commission, a quarterly accelerator above target, and clawback provisions for cancelled orders. Ms. Brandt presented modelling showing a neutral cost impact at current attainment levels. The board approved the scheme in principle, pending legal review of the clawback wording. Members should note the confidential business item recorded below.

internal memo for kawip-hadug: Headcount on the Wenwyn team goes from 7 to 140 by the end of January. Gross margin on Wenwyn came in at 20 percent against a plan of 15 percent.

## Action item: PM-2291 follow-up

During the Veltway outage, the elevator-dispatch simulator (Hoistline) kept accepting dispatch requests after its state store went read-only, producing stale car assignments for 40 minutes. Action: add a health gate that halts dispatch when store writes fail, and page on-call within two minutes. Owner: the Hoistline squad. Implementation notes and the test harness are described here.

runbook for badug-kadup: https://confluence.zemvarlabs.internal/projects/browse/display/projects/bd1b